The 25th Amendment: A Constitutional Safeguard

The 25th Amendment, a crucial part of our Constitution, outlines the process for presidential succession in cases of incapacity. Enacted after President Kennedy’s assassination, it ensures leadership continuity and preparedness for various scenarios.
